Leon … Scotland was traditionally divided into four regions: Campbeltown, The Highlands, The Isle of Islay and The Lowlands. Due to the large number of distilleries found there, the Speyside area became the fifth, recognised by the Scotch Whisky Association (SWA) as a distinct region in 2014. WebJul 16, 2024 · The regions of Scotch whisky. Wikimedia Commons. Geographically, the world of single malts is divided into five regions. These regions are protected in UK law, to ensure that a Scotch that's labeled with a certain region is actually made in that region. The five regions are Speyside, the Lowlands, the Highlands, Islay, and Campbeltown.
